Output 75f30cc8271c0ea77902880675cdcbe0d7f6d4bad8e2e32bfec2f3baf94ec62b: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719ad6ea323734874d9200c34ede4057d839e957 OP_EQUAL
address
3C3hmf9Cg9bBvQdrLbaSivWMM2a8sUAyxw
transaction
75f30cc8271c0ea77902880675cdcbe0d7f6d4bad8e2e32bfec2f3baf94ec62b